Historical Landmarks and City Icons

Explore Chişinău's rich history through its iconic landmarks. The Triumphal Arch stands proudly in the city center. It commemorates Russia's victory over the Ottoman Empire. This arch was built in 1840, offering a grand sight. It is a perfect spot for memorable photos.

Adjacent to the arch is Cathedral Park, a green oasis. Here you will find the Nativity Cathedral. This beautiful structure dates back to 1830. Its neoclassical design is truly impressive. Consider a Chişinău walking tour to explore these sites effectively.

The Stefan cel Mare Monument honors Moldova's national hero. It is located at the entrance to Stefan cel Mare Park. This monument reflects the nation's resilience. It stands as a symbol of Moldovan independence. Learn more about Moldova's past at these significant spots.

Near the monument, you will find the Government House. This imposing building showcases Soviet-era architecture. You can appreciate its scale from outside. These central Chişinău attractions are easily accessible. They form the heart of the city's historical district.

Just a short walk away, you'll discover more hidden gems. The Parliament building also features interesting architecture. Many historical churches dot the downtown area. Seek out the small, older buildings for a glimpse of old Chişinău. Most sites are free to view or have minimal entry fees. Check for specific opening hours in 2025. Lush Green Spaces and Parks

Chişinău is renowned for its abundant green spaces. Stefan cel Mare Park is the oldest park in the city. It offers tranquil paths and beautiful flower beds. Many locals relax here, enjoying the serene atmosphere. It's a perfect spot for an afternoon stroll.

Valea Morilor Park is another vast green area. It features a large artificial lake. You can rent paddle boats during warmer months. The park includes a beautiful cascade staircase. The Botanical Garden showcases diverse plant species. It is located on the city's southeastern edge. This garden offers stunning seasonal displays. Entry fees are typically around 10-20 MDL (about $0.50-$1 USD). Opening hours are usually 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M. Check for updated 2025 schedules.

For more natural beauty, visit Dendrarium Park. This park features various tree and shrub collections. It is a peaceful retreat from urban life. Many pathways wind through different plant sections.

These parks are mostly free to enter. Some have small fees for specific sections. Enjoy jogging or cycling on dedicated paths. Children will love the playgrounds available. Engaging Museums and Cultural Experiences

Dive into Moldova's rich heritage at Chişinău's museums. The National Museum of History of Moldova is a must-visit. It covers the country's past from ancient times. Exhibits range from archaeology to modern history. Allow at least two hours for your visit.

Another excellent choice is the National Museum of Ethnography and Natural History. This museum displays Moldovan traditions and nature. You will see traditional costumes and artifacts. It also features impressive geological and biological collections. Entry typically costs around 10-30 MDL. Many museums close on Mondays, so plan accordingly for 2025.

Literature enthusiasts can visit the Pushkin House Museum. This museum is dedicated to the famous Russian poet. Alexander Pushkin lived here in exile. It offers a glimpse into his life in Chişinău. The entrance fee is usually minimal. It provides a unique cultural perspective. You might want to try Chişinău's local food after your visit.

For a different cultural experience, attend a show at the Organ Hall. This stunning former bank building hosts concerts. Enjoy classical music in a grand setting. Check their official website for event schedules. Tickets can vary from 50-200 MDL (about $2.50-$10 USD).

Beyond these, consider the National Art Museum of Moldova. It houses impressive Moldovan and European art. Look for temporary exhibitions during your visit. These cultural institutions provide deep insights. They reveal the soul of Moldova. Most are open Tuesday through Sunday. Confirm specific hours and entry fees for 2025. Unique Tastes and Wine Experiences

Chişinău offers incredible culinary adventures. The Central Market (Piaţa Centrală) is a vibrant hub. Explore local produce, fresh meats, and cheeses. You will find traditional Moldovan delicacies here. This market provides a true taste of local life. Prepare to haggle for the best prices.

Moldova is famous for its exceptional wines. A visit to Chişinău is incomplete without wine tasting. Many renowned wineries are just a short drive away. Cricova Winery is one of the most famous. It boasts an underground city of wine cellars. Mimi Castle offers a luxurious wine experience. These are among the country's premier Chişinău wine tasting tours.

Winery tours typically include tasting sessions. Prices range from 300-800 MDL (about $15-$40 USD). Booking in advance is highly recommended. Especially for 2025, tour slots fill quickly. Transportation to wineries can be arranged. Most tours last between 2-4 hours.

At the Central Market, look for *plăcinte* (savory pastries). Also try *mămăligă* (polenta) with local cheese. The market is open daily from early morning. Wineries have specific tour hours. Practical Tips for Visiting Chişinău Attractions

Planning your visit to Chişinău attractions is easy. The city center is very walkable. Many key sites are close together. Public transport is affordable and efficient. Trolleybuses cover most major routes. A single ride costs around 2-3 MDL (about $0.10-$0.15 USD).

Consider purchasing a local SIM card upon arrival. This helps with navigation and communication. Ride-sharing apps like Yandex Go are also available. They offer convenient and reasonably priced transport. Chişinău airport transfers can be pre-booked. This ensures a smooth start to your journey.

The best time to visit is spring or early autumn. The weather is pleasant then. Crowds are also typically smaller. Summers can be hot, with more tourists. Winters offer a festive but colder experience. Consult our guide on the best time to visit Chişinău for specific details.

Budgeting for Chişinău is relatively easy. Most attractions are inexpensive or free. Food and accommodation are also quite affordable. A daily budget of $30-$50 USD is sufficient. This covers attractions, meals, and transport.

When planning your itinerary, consider grouping nearby attractions. This minimizes travel time between sites. Wear comfortable shoes for walking tours. Always carry water during warmer months. Are there good options for day trips from Chişinău?

Absolutely, Chişinău serves as a great base for day trips. The most popular options are the famous Moldovan wineries. Cricova and Mileștii Mici offer amazing underground tours. Orheiul Vechi is a historical and archaeological complex. It features cave monasteries and stunning landscapes.
